Warning Signs You Need Concrete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ring the warning signs of concrete water damage can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. Here are some common sign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ors that linger long after the source of the moisture has been addressed. This is a sign that mold and mildew have taken hold and need to be addressed.

Warped or Buckled Concrete

Conrete that’s warped or buckled can be a sign of underlying structural damage. This can lead to further problems, including cracks and even collapse.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on your concrete surfaces can show a bigger problem. Ignoring these signs can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

Increased Humidity or Moisture

High levels of humidity or moisture in the air can lead to mold and mildew growth, which can be a sign of concrete water damage.

Cracks or Fissures

Cracks or fissures in your concrete can be a sign of underlying structural damage. This can lead to further problems, including water infiltration and damage to surrounding areas.

Water Accumulation or Puddling

Water accumulation or puddling on your concrete surfaces can be a sign of a bigger problem. Ignoring these signs can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

Concrete Water Damage Restoration Cost in Hurstbourne, KY

The cost of concrete water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500-$2,500 The size and complexity of the affected area, as well as the severity of the damage.
Moisture Detection and Measurement $200-$1,000 The number and type of equipment used, as well as the time required to complete the assessment.
Drying Protocols $1,000-$5,000 The type and quantity of equipment used, as well as the time required to complete the drying process.
Equipment Selection and Placement $500-$2,000 The type and quantity of equipment used, as well as the time required to complete the setup.
Post-Drying Inspection $200-$1,000 The time required to complete the inspection, as well as any more repairs or recommendations.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and the specifics of your situation. We offer free estimates and consultations to help you understand the costs involved.
